KFC: Founding ColonelTop 6: February 6th 2019
In celebration of the Singapore Bicentennial, together with the signature KFC wit and lightheartedness, KFC has placed a real-life statue of their own founding father, Colonel Sanders, by the Singapore River. The idea was born between KFC and the Ogilvy Singapore, to pay homage to the Founding Colonel of the world’s favourite fried chicken brand, with a sense of humour. Building an exact replica of the original and new founding father statues, the KFC version had a twist - a real human posing as the statue. This year marks the 200th year since Sir Stamford Raffles landed on Singapore and the nation has also recognised other prominent founding fathers with their statues erected along the Singapore River: Sang Nila Utama, Munshi Abdullah, Naraina Pillai, and Tan Tock Seng. On one historic day in 1977, Colonal Sanders, too, landed in Singapore and "changed Singaporeans’ taste buds forever".
